by admin on July 30, 2012

Racing down the 1/4 mile track at St. Thomas Dragstrip near Port Burwell. At the DBSC Scooter Rally 2012! Lambretta Fan.

Heading to Port Burwell 2012

by admin on July 26, 2012

Heading to the DBSC Port Burwell Rally 2012. See you soon! Lambretta Fan